More than 20,000 teachers nationwide trained to improve digital transformation capacity in education

GD&TĐ - The training series not only introduces digital transformation tools but also focuses on instructing teachers on how to apply them effectively in educational activities.

Báo Giáo dục và Thời đạiBáo Giáo dục và Thời đại10/09/2025

Enhancing digital transformation capacity in education

The training took place from August 15 to August 28, with 7 topics, attracting the participation of more than 20,000 teachers nationwide. The training sessions revolved around two main groups of topics: Analysis of Math exam questions (10th grade admission and high school graduation in 2025) and Digital transformation in teaching and education management, associated with new trends such as STEM and AI.

The online training program "Improving capacity for digital transformation in education" is organized by the OLM digital education platform with the goal of contributing to supporting schools and teachers to effectively implement the 2018 General Education Program, while improving capacity for digital transformation in education and building the second session education plan, developing scientific research and technological innovation capabilities for students.

Not only stopping at introducing an overview of digital transformation tools, each training session also focuses on improving teachers' practical capacity. The training method harmoniously combines theory and practice, helping teachers grasp quickly, understand deeply and apply immediately to teaching and management work.

One of the key contents of the training program is "Digital transformation in teaching and learning on the OLM Digital Education platform", helping teachers access and effectively exploit modern digital tools.

First, teachers were given an overview of the OLM platform, thereby having a clear view of the technology ecosystem supporting teaching. Next, the training session focused on exploring outstanding features such as: A rich digital learning materials system, online assignment tools and detailed learning outcome statistics, helping teachers closely monitor students' learning progress. In particular, the part on creating learning materials received a lot of attention, when teachers were guided to practice creating interactive videos, building tests and practice exercises in multiple choice format according to the standards of the Ministry of Education and Training along with essay format.

“What I appreciate most after the training session is that OLM provides a comprehensive educational ecosystem. With a smart question bank, a diverse learning material library and the personal assignment feature, I can easily assign advanced lessons to good students and reinforce lessons to slow students. This is really the key to both supporting students to improve their learning and significantly reducing the workload for teachers,” shared Ms. Vu Thi Kim Ngan - Yen Nguyen Primary School (Tuyen Quang).

Mr. Nguyen Danh Diep - Dom Cang Primary and Secondary School (Son La) said: "Through OLM training sessions, it has helped spread and create positive effects among the teaching staff, thereby helping each teacher to change and adapt to the application of online platforms and digital transformation tools in management and teaching work.

What I found most useful was the detailed instructions on how to apply OLM in building and arranging a convenient timetable. The direct instructions and specific illustrative situations helped me grasp the concept easily and I can immediately apply it to my work in the next school year."

Building a STEM lesson plan according to the 2018 General Education Program

Another important content of the training session is the topic "Building a STEM lesson plan according to the 2018 General Education Program", to help teachers better understand the trends and methods of effectively implementing STEM. Teachers were introduced to the program framework and orientation of STEM education according to the 2018 General Education Program, thereby clearly understanding the role and requirements to achieve. The next content focuses on exploiting and using technology in STEM education, helping teachers apply software and digital tools to increase experience and interaction in the teaching and learning process.

Teachers also get to explore a number of STEM topics in specific subjects, from Mathematics, Natural Sciences to Technology, making integration more accessible and feasible. Finally, the program emphasizes the skills of building STEM education plans in schools, helping the school board and professional teams have a clear roadmap, suitable for practical conditions.

Ms. Nguyen Thi Hien - Phu Tien Primary School (Thai Nguyen) said: "The content about STEM and AI has given me many ideas to organize science and technology experience activities in class, stimulating creativity and interest in learning for students. This is a practical luggage for me to improve the quality of teaching in the coming time. In particular, the guidance on building a STEM education plan in schools is very practical, helping us to no longer be vague but have a clear direction to implement in specific steps, suitable for the actual conditions of the classroom and school".

Teachers participating in the training highly appreciated the practicality of the program, which has brought benefits to education, from digitizing records, automatic exam grading, optimizing learning management to increasing interaction in the classroom.

Along with the advantages, OLM experts also pointed out some weaknesses and challenges that many schools and teachers are facing when applying digital transformation such as: lack of synchronization in data management between departments; limited digital skills of a part of teachers, causing slow technology deployment, limited resources for infrastructure and equipment investment.

To overcome this, OLM experts have suggested many practical solutions. “Digital transformation in education is not a race in technology, but a journey to change thinking and management methods. Schools can start with small steps such as digitizing student records, applying online classroom management tools, then gradually expanding, regularly organizing training to improve teacher capacity. The most important thing is the consensus from the school board to teachers, so that digital transformation can truly go into depth and be sustainable”, Mr. Ha Duc Tho - Director of Education Science and Technology Joint Stock Company (owner of the OLM ecosystem) emphasized.

OLM is an integrated platform for teaching, learning, education management and quality digital science resources, applying modern technology to bring about breakthrough changes in education.

For schools: Comprehensive management of teaching and learning processes, from student records, digital learning materials to large-scale automated testing and assessment.

For teachers: Provides teaching management tools (assigning assignments, grading, creating exams, question banks) and learning materials (self-created learning materials and OLM learning materials), along with detailed reports on student learning outcomes.

Students: Self-study proactively with a rich system of lectures, exercises and a test bank that closely follows the program of the Ministry of Education and Training. Students can practice, take tests, participate in the Q&A community and weekly knowledge competitions.

Parents: Monitor your child's learning progress, connect with teachers and schools to support student learning both at school and at home.
